Position Summary
Working from a solutions-oriented approach, the Certified Nurse Midwife delivers primary care commensurate with training and monitors clinical performance to ensure medical services and operations comply with all applicable regulatory and licensing agencies.
Responsibilities
· Provides direct clinical medical services in the area of board certified (or board eligible) medical specialty in accordance with the highest applicable standards of medical and professional practice and in full accordance with health center protocols and policies.
· Acts as a consultant on women's health cases referred by other staff providers of HCHC.
· From time to time, provides in-service training for staff in selected topics in Family Medicine and Woman's health as deemed necessary by the Medical Director.
· Completes medical documentation representing patient encounters within 3 business days of the patient encounter.
· Applies for and obtains staff privileges at community hospitals in the area as appropriate.
· Demonstrates commitment to and understanding of HCHC's recognition as a Patient Centered Medical Home and its associated service excellence standards by modeling excellence in all clinical, administrative and team process relationships, addressing service excellence deficits as may be identified and in performance of all duties and responsibilities as a Certified Nurse Midwife of the HCHC.
· Other duties and responsibilities as assigned.

Education and Experience
· Current and Unrestricted license to practice medicine in the Commonwealth of Virginia.
· DEA license to prescribe medicine.
· Board certification in chosen field of practice. Cannot be sanctioned under Medicaid or Medicare.
· Maintains federal, state and professional licenses/qualifications to maintain scope of practice in Virginia.
· Current CPR (BLS) certificate is required.
· Previous experience working in a Community Health Center environment is preferred.
